Rent of the Property
Determining the right rental charge of your property is very much important. Know the value of your property and also the other expenses that you invested on your property and choose the right rent. While determining the rent you should consider the location where your property is located, the type of the property you have, amenities you are providing to the tenants and the also the charges of similar properties nearby.

Screening Tenant
Without screening tenants you cannot take the risk to hire bad tenants for your rental property as you can be in big trouble in future. So, talk to their previous landlord to know about their behaviour and also ask about whether or not they used to pay the rent on the time. Do a background check, criminal record and credit history to know they are good and right tenant for your property.

Making of Lease Agreement
One of the most of important things while giving your property on lease is making the lease agreement. The absence of rental or lease agreement can put you in trouble and which may end at court. This is a legal written document that is a proof that you have allowed the tenants to occupy the space in your rental apartment. This will include all the important things like the name of the tenants, the number of persons will occupy the property, security deposit, terms and conditions of the owner for the tenants and much more.

Security Deposit
There are many who do not charge security deposit to the tenants but it is actually important for keeping your property safe. The tenants will become more careful and alert, they know that if they will do any mistake then they will not get back the full amount of the security money deposited by them. And if they make any damage to the property or break the lease agreement early then you can keep all or the part of security deposit as penalty from the tenants.
